Company A has 20,000 bonds outstanding, each with a face value of $1,000. 12,000 of the 20,000 bonds pay a semi-annual coupon of 8% p.a. with 10 years left to maturity and an effective annual yield to maturity of 10%. 8,000 of the 20,000 bonds pay an annual coupon of 9% p.a. with 12 years left to maturity and an effective annual yield to maturity of 11%. The most recent coupon for both types of bonds have just been paid. Effective tax rate is 30%. A has 10 million ordinary shares outstanding which are currently trading at $5 per share. A's beta is 1.2, the risk-free rate is 3%, and the expected return on the market portfolio is 15%. Using the capital asset pricing model to estimate the cost of equity, what is A's after-tax weighted average cost of capital?
